How to remove spurious oscillations for shear stress?
 
Using RANS model for backstep and all is good except the anisotropic component of the shear stress where there is a lot of oscillation at the region of flow separation. I can't remove them even at high mesh density. Any recommendation to remove them?

I am not sure if mesh density is the issue here.

To reduce spurious oscillations, damping factors can be implemented mainly in implicit time integration schemes. The bulk viscosity method (BVM) is an explicit scheme for damping spurious oscillation, used in commercial types of software such as LS-DYNA and ABAQUS.
